This book focuses on space in African and Black religion and spirituality through the lenses of area studies, African and black diaspora studies, history and culture, cultural studies, ecotourism, environmentalism, and sustainability.

Author Biography

'BioDun J. Ogundayo is associate professor of French and comparative literature at the University of Pittsburgh. Julius O. Adekunle is professor of African history at Monmouth University.
